The 2003–2018 Interval in Development Finance and the “revival” of Development Banking in Greece Within the European Context (2019–Today)

This chapter examines the current phase of development banking in Greece with the establishment of the Hellenic Development Bank in 2019 as the successor to the development funds established in 2003 and 2011. The role of this national development bank, within the European framework and the new international standards, is analyzed, and its prospects are assessed in the light of both the previous historical experience of Greek development banking and the proposed institutional model. Primary data drawn from annual financial statements and Reports are also presented.
